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
973685566 25942934 8240
2558 8759058599
2558 8759058599
50631 815 06 95921 51
All about undefined
Interested in learning more?
2558 8759058599
50631 815 06 95921 51
See more
36445436917 3950237952
51007579 872 851953524
See more
38463657459 5729390512
518 765 89169314 7904891613
See more